来年は四月十一日まで四月十七日からかぞくと日本のきゅしゅへ行く事にします.

"I have decided to go to Kyushu, Japan with my family next year from the 11th to the 17th of April."

I think you got the basics all right, but there are some small errors that need to be modified.
👍

来年の四月十一日から四月十七日までかぞく(家族)と 日本のきゅうしゅう(九州)へ行くことにしました。

~から~まで from ~ to ~
九州(きゅうしゅう)
事 is usually written in katakana when saying ~ことにする
します is present tense or general statement.
As you have already decided it should be past tense しました which means completion.

No, you should not add を here... For 行きたい the particle へ showing direction (to Nagasaki and Ooita) is already used.

特に
長崎県と大分県と佐賀県へ行きたい.
You can add 特に before 行きたい but normally it can be put at the beginning of the sentence.
